Tender Title:

Facility Management Services - SITC of HVLC Fan
Reference Number: GEM/2025/B/6168641

Issuing Authority/Department:

Home Department, Madhya Pradesh

Scope of Work and Objectives:

The primary objective of this tender is to procure Facility Management Services along with the Supply, Installation, Testing, and Commissioning (SITC) of High Volume Low Speed (HVLS) fans. The selected service provider will be responsible for delivering a lump-sum service that includes the installation of HVLS fans, which must come with a minimum warranty of one year. Additionally, the service provider is required to supply consumables necessary for the operation and maintenance of the installed equipment, all of which must be included in the contract cost.
